What is Photorejuvenation?
Photorejuvenation uses a series of Intense Pulsed Light
(IPL) treatments at a frequency that targets pigmented
cells. The light passes harmlessly through the skin and
is absorbed by spots and lesions. The abnormal cells are
destroyed, leaving only healthy tissue. IPL also
stimulates the growth of collagen, fills in acne scars,
decreases pore size and gives skin a youthful
appearance.

What does the treatment entail?
The skin is cleansed, prepared with gel and then treated
with the light. Afterwards, the gel is cleaned off and
replaced with sunscreen. Cold compresses may be used if
needed.
What are the benefits of Photorejuvenation?
Photorejuvenation's short treatment time, quick effects
and lack of downtime make it popular. This treatment
gives skin a healthy, youthful look and decreases the
appearance of blemishes such as acne scars, brown spots
and redness from rosacea.
How many treatments are required?
The standard treatment is a series of three to five
treatments performed at three to four week intervals.
Some may be satisfied with the results from two or three
sessions, and some may desire additional sessions.
Is
Photorejuvenation safe?
Yes it is a safe, common and quick procedure
with little risk.
Are there any possible side effects?
You may experience a sunburned look for a few hours
after treatment, and targeted spots will temporarily
appear darker and flake off in a couple of days. Hair
growth may be affected. Swelling, blistering, infection,
unwanted pigmentation changes and scarring are rare side
effects. Existing viral infections such as shingles and
herpes may be activated by the treatment.
What conditions respond best to this treatment?
Rosacea, age spots, enlarged pores, freckles and sun
spots all respond well to Photorejuvenation.
Will there be any downtime?
No, you may immediately return to your normal routine
and even apply makeup.
What can be expected post-treatment?
Your skin will be sensitive and will need to be
protected from the sun. Any swelling will be minimal and
can be treated with cold compresses. Dark spots from the
treatment should flake off after a few days.
How soon will results appear?
Noticeable results appear after the first few
treatments.
How long does a Photorejuvenation treatment last?
A session lasts about a half an hour.
Who should avoid Photorejuvenation?
You may want to reconsider having Photorejuvenation if
you have a history of excessive scarring, bleeding or
bruising, sun sensitivity, keloid formation or poor
healing. Those with a family history of skin cancer
should talk to a specialist about whether or not to
proceed.
How does the treatment feel?
You will experience some discomfort. Most find the
treatment to be similar to the sensation of a rubber
band snapping against the skin.
How long do the results last?
The effects of Photorejuvenation can be permanent if the
skin is well cared for.
What are the alternative treatments?
There are other light treatments and topical creams that
may be used instead. You should consult a specialist, as
Photorejuvenation will not treat the underlying
conditions causing your problem areas.
What are the limitations?
Those with darker skin are less likely to see results
and more likely to experience adverse side effects.
Instructions for before treatment:
Discontinue use of Accutane® for six months, Retin-A®
for two weeks and glycolic acid and alpha-hydroxy acid
products for a week before your treatment. Avoid sun and
sunless tanning for four weeks. Do not take aspirin or
other blood thinners for at least three days before your
treatment. You cannot be treated while you have
infections or sores in the area.
Instructions for after treatment:
Protect your skin with moisturizers and sunscreen. Cold
compresses and steroid creams may be used as necessary.
Avoid irritating your skin, and keep away from the sun
and sunless tanners for a couple of weeks.
